Washington state parks and recreation commission plate. (Effective until July 1, 2011.)

The department shall issue a special license plate displaying a symbol or artwork, as approved by the special license plate review board and the legislature before June 30, 2010, recognizing Washington state parks as premier destinations of uncommon quality that preserve significant natural, cultural, historical, and recreational resources, that may be used in lieu of regular or personalized license plates for vehicles required to display one and two vehicle license plates, excluding vehicles registered under chapter 46.87 RCW, upon terms and conditions established by the department.

[2010 1st sp.s. c 7 § 102; 2005 c 44 § 1.]

Notes: Effective date -- 2010 1st sp.s. c 26; 2010 1st sp.s. c 7: See note following RCW 43.03.027.
